Prividera, Interim Associate Director and Graduate Studies Coordinator, 116 Joyner East The School of Communication offers a master of arts in communication with an emphasis in health communication. Admission to this program requires that the applicant meet the admissions requirements of the Graduate School, as well as the School of Communication. MA in CommunicationThe MA in communication prepares students for careers or advanced academic training in communication with an emphasis in health communication focusing on interpersonal communication and the media. The 30-hour program provides students with a thesis or non-thesis option.
